public class LabelContentViewer extends org.eclipse.jface.viewers.Viewer implements org.eclipse.compare.IPropertyChangeNotifier, CommandStackListener
| Constructor and Description |
|---|
LabelContentViewer(org.eclipse.swt.widgets.Composite parent,
String title,
String message,
EMFCompareConfiguration configuration)
Creates a new viewer and its controls.
|
| Modifier and Type | Method and Description |
|---|---|
void |
addPropertyChangeListener(org.eclipse.jface.util.IPropertyChangeListener listener) |
void |
commandStackChanged(EventObject event) |
void |
editingDomainChange(ICompareEditingDomainChange event) |
void |
editingDomainChange(ICompareEditingDomain oldValue,
ICompareEditingDomain newValue) |
org.eclipse.swt.widgets.Control |
getControl() |
Object |
getInput() |
org.eclipse.jface.viewers.ISelection |
getSelection() |
protected void |
handleDisposed() |
void |
refresh() |
void |
removePropertyChangeListener(org.eclipse.jface.util.IPropertyChangeListener listener) |
protected void |
setDirty(boolean dirty) |
void |
setInput(Object input) |
void |
setSelection(org.eclipse.jface.viewers.ISelection selection,
boolean reveal) |
public LabelContentViewer(org.eclipse.swt.widgets.Composite parent,
String title,
String message,
EMFCompareConfiguration configuration)
parent - the parent of the control of this viewer.public void setSelection(org.eclipse.jface.viewers.ISelection selection,
boolean reveal)
setSelection in class org.eclipse.jface.viewers.ViewerViewer.setSelection(org.eclipse.jface.viewers.ISelection, boolean)public void setInput(Object input)
setInput in class org.eclipse.jface.viewers.ViewerViewer.setInput(java.lang.Object)public void refresh()
refresh in class org.eclipse.jface.viewers.ViewerViewer.refresh()public org.eclipse.jface.viewers.ISelection getSelection()
getSelection in interface org.eclipse.jface.viewers.ISelectionProvidergetSelection in class org.eclipse.jface.viewers.ViewerViewer.getSelection()public Object getInput()
getInput in interface org.eclipse.jface.viewers.IInputProvidergetInput in class org.eclipse.jface.viewers.ViewerViewer.getInput()public org.eclipse.swt.widgets.Control getControl()
getControl in class org.eclipse.jface.viewers.ViewerViewer.getControl()public void addPropertyChangeListener(org.eclipse.jface.util.IPropertyChangeListener listener)
addPropertyChangeListener in interface org.eclipse.compare.IPropertyChangeNotifierpublic void removePropertyChangeListener(org.eclipse.jface.util.IPropertyChangeListener listener)
removePropertyChangeListener in interface org.eclipse.compare.IPropertyChangeNotifierpublic void editingDomainChange(ICompareEditingDomainChange event)
oldValue - newValue - public void editingDomainChange(ICompareEditingDomain oldValue, ICompareEditingDomain newValue)
protected void setDirty(boolean dirty)
public void commandStackChanged(EventObject event)
commandStackChanged in interface CommandStackListenerprotected void handleDisposed()
Copyright (c) 2006, 2015 Obeo and others. All rights reserved.